Do uPVC windows need any maintenance?
Not much, but not none. Wipe the frames a few times a year, lubricate hinges and locks annually, and keep the drainage channels along the bottom of the frame clear so water can't pool and find its way inside. There is no statutory annual service like a boiler needs.
Is new double glazing covered by a warranty?
uPVC frames typically carry a 10 year manufacturer or insurance-backed guarantee, and sealed glazed units are usually guaranteed separately for 5 to 10 years against misting. Register the guarantee after installation and keep the FENSA or Certass certificate — a buyer's solicitor will ask for it if you sell the property.
